Cell Phone Catches Fire, Ignites Pillow
The NYPD’s 33rd Precinct is warning people not to place their cell phones under their pillows while sleeping or while recharging them, after an incident in Brooklyn Heights in which a cell phone overheated, erupted into flames and ignited a local resident’s pillow while she was sleeping on it.

Tornado Hits North Miami Beach
What appears to have been a tornado ripped through North Miami Beach a short while ago, lifting cars off the road, causing damage and wide-spread power outages. North Miami Beach is home to South Florida’s largest Orthodox-Jewish community, and its largest Lubavitch community as well.
